Tex. Labor Code Section 412.0121
Interagency Contracts


(a)

Each state agency shall enter into an interagency contract with the office under Chapter 771 (Interagency Cooperation Act), Government Code, to pay the costs incurred by the office in administering this chapter for the benefit of that state agency.

(b)

Costs payable under the contract include the cost of:

(1)

services of office employees;

(2)

materials; and

(3)

equipment, including computer hardware and software.

(c)

The costs of risk management services provided by a state agency under the interagency contract shall be allocated in the same proportion and determined in the same manner as the costs of workers’ compensation.

Text of section as renumbered from Labor Code Sec. 412.012 (Funding)(b) and amended by Acts 2001, 77th Leg., ch. 1017, Sec. 1.02

(b)

Costs payable under the contract include the cost of:

(1)

services of office employees;

(2)

materials; and

(3)

equipment, including computer hardware and software.

(c)

The amount of the costs to be paid by a state agency under the interagency contract is based on:

(1)

the number of employees of the agency compared with the total number of employees of all state agencies to which this chapter applies;

(2)

the dollar value of the agency’s property and asset and liability exposure compared to that of all state agencies to which this chapter applies; and

(3)

the number and aggregate cost of claims and losses incurred by the state agency compared to those incurred by all state agencies to which this chapter applies.

(d)

The board may by rule establish the formula for allocating the cost of this chapter in an interagency contract in a manner that gives consideration to the factors in Subsection (c) and any other factors it deems relevant, including an agency’s risk management expenditures, unique risks, and established programs.
